Validate CAdES-T Signature (.p7m)

See more CAdES Examples

Validates a CAdES-T CMS signature and extracts the time-stamp token and gets information about it. Also validates the time-stamp token.

Chilkat PowerShell Downloads

PowerShell
Add-Type -Path "C:\chilkat\ChilkatDotNet47-x64\ChilkatDotNet47.dll"

$success = $false

#  This example requires the Chilkat API to have been previously unlocked.
#  See Global Unlock Sample for sample code.

$crypt = New-Object Chilkat.Crypt2

#  Indicate that the CAdES-T timestamp tokens must also pass validation for the signature to be validated.
$cmsOptions = New-Object Chilkat.JsonObject
$cmsOptions.UpdateBool("ValidateTimestampTokens",$true)
$crypt.CmsOptions = $cmsOptions.Emit()

#  Validate the .p7m and extract the original signed data to an output file.
#  Note: The timestampToken is an unauthenticated attribute.  See the code below that retrieves and parses the last JSON data.
#  for details about examining timestampToken.
$success = $crypt.VerifyP7M("qa_data/cades/CAdES-T/Signature-C-T-1.p7m","qa_output/out.dat")

#  Get information about the CMS signature in the last JSON data.
#  The detailed results of the signature validation are available in the last JSON data.
#  (If the non-success return status was caused by an error such as "file not found", then the
#  last JSON data would be empty.)
$json = New-Object Chilkat.JsonObject
$crypt.GetLastJsonData($json)
$json.EmitCompact = $false
$($json.Emit())

$signingTime = New-Object Chilkat.DtObj

$authAttrSigningTimeUtctime = New-Object Chilkat.DtObj

$unauthAttrTimestampTokenTstInfoGenTime = New-Object Chilkat.DtObj

#  Iterate over the hash algorithms used in the signature.
$i = 0
$count_i = $json.SizeOfArray("pkcs7.verify.digestAlgorithms")
while ($i -lt $count_i) {
    $json.I = $i
    $strVal = $json.StringOf("pkcs7.verify.digestAlgorithms[i]")
    $i = $i + 1
}

#  For each signer...
$i = 0
$count_i = $json.SizeOfArray("pkcs7.verify.signerInfo")
while ($i -lt $count_i) {
    $json.I = $i

    #  Get information about the certificate used by this signer.
    $certSerialNumber = $json.StringOf("pkcs7.verify.signerInfo[i].cert.serialNumber")
    $certIssuerCN = $json.StringOf("pkcs7.verify.signerInfo[i].cert.issuerCN")
    $certIssuerDN = $json.StringOf("pkcs7.verify.signerInfo[i].cert.issuerDN")
    $certDigestAlgOid = $json.StringOf("pkcs7.verify.signerInfo[i].cert.digestAlgOid")
    $certDigestAlgName = $json.StringOf("pkcs7.verify.signerInfo[i].cert.digestAlgName")

    #  Get additional information for this signer, such as the signingTime, signature algorithm, etc.
    $contentType = $json.StringOf("pkcs7.verify.signerInfo[i].contentType")
    $json.DtOf("pkcs7.verify.signerInfo[i].signingTime",$false,$signingTime)
    $messageDigest = $json.StringOf("pkcs7.verify.signerInfo[i].messageDigest")
    $signingAlgOid = $json.StringOf("pkcs7.verify.signerInfo[i].signingAlgOid")
    $signingAlgName = $json.StringOf("pkcs7.verify.signerInfo[i].signingAlgName")

    #  --------------------------------
    #  Examine authenticated attributes.
    #  --------------------------------

    #  contentType
    if ($json.HasMember("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.3`"") -eq $true) {
        $authAttrContentTypeName =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.3`".name")
        $authAttrContentTypeOid =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.3`".oid")
    }

    #  signingTime
    if ($json.HasMember("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.5`"") -eq $true) {
        $authAttrSigningTimeName =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.5`".name")
        $json.DtO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.5`".utctime",$false,$authAttrSigningTimeUtctime)
    }

    #  messageDigest
    if ($json.HasMember("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.4`"") -eq $true) {
        $authAttrMessageDigestName =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.4`".name")
        $authAttrMessageDigestDigest =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.4`".digest")
    }

    #  signingCertificateV2
    if ($json.HasMember("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.16.2.47`"") -eq $true) {
        $authAttrSigningCertificateV2Name =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.16.2.47`".name")
        $authAttrSigningCertificateV2Der = $json.StringOf("pkcs7.verify.signerInfo[i].authAttr.`"1.2.840.113549.1.9.16.2.47`".der")
    }

    #  --------------------------------
    #  Examine unauthenticated attributes.
    #  --------------------------------

    #  timestampToken  (the timestampToken is what makes this signature a CAdES-T)
    if ($json.HasMember("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`"") -eq $true) {

        $unauthAttrTimestampTokenName =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".name")
        $unauthAttrTimestampTokenDer =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".der")

        #  This is where we find out if the timestampToken's signature is valid.
        $unauthAttrTimestampTokenTimestampSignatureVerified = $json.BoolO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".timestampSignatureVerified")

        $unauthAttrTimestampTokenTstInfoTsaPolicyId =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".tstInfo.tsaPolicyId")
        $unauthAttrTimestampTokenTstInfoMessageImprintHashAlg =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".tstInfo.messageImprint.hashAlg")
        $unauthAttrTimestampTokenTstInfoMessageImprintDigest =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".tstInfo.messageImprint.digest")

        #  Here is where we check to see if the digest in the timestampToken's messageImprint matches the digest of the signature of this signerInfo
        $unauthAttrTimestampTokenTstInfoMessageImprintDigestMatches = $json.BoolO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".tstInfo.messageImprint.digestMatches")

        $unauthAttrTimestampTokenTstInfoSerialNumber =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".tstInfo.serialNumber")

        #  Here is where we get the date/time of the timestampToken (i.e. when it was timestamped)
        $json.DtO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".tstInfo.genTime",$false,$unauthAttrTimestampTokenTstInfoGenTime)

        #  The following code gets details about the validity of the timestampToken's signature...
        $j = 0
        $count_j = $json.SizeOfArray("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.digestAlgorithms")
        while ($j -lt $count_j) {
            $json.J = $j
            $strVal =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.digestAlgorithms[j]")
            $j = $j + 1
        }

        $j = 0
        $count_j = $json.SizeOfArray("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o")
        while ($j -lt $count_j) {
            $json.J = $j
            $certSerialNumber =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].cert.serialNumber")
            $certIssuerCN =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].cert.issuerCN")
            $certIssuerDN =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].cert.issuerDN")
            $certDigestAlgOid =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].cert.digestAlgOid")
            $certDigestAlgName =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].cert.digestAlgName")
            $contentType =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].contentType")
            $messageDigest =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].messageDigest")
            $signingAlgOid =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].signingAlgOid")
            $signingAlgName =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].signingAlgName")
            $authAttrContentTypeName =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].authAttr.`"1.2.840.113549.1.9.3`".name")
            $authAttrContentTypeOid =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].authAttr.`"1.2.840.113549.1.9.3`".oid")
            $authAttrMessageDigestName =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].authAttr.`"1.2.840.113549.1.9.4`".name")
            $authAttrMessageDigestDigest =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].authAttr.`"1.2.840.113549.1.9.4`".digest")
            $authAttrSigningCertificateV2Name =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].authAttr.`"1.2.840.113549.1.9.16.2.47`".name")
            $authAttrSigningCertificateV2Der = $json.StringOf("pkcs7.verify.signerInfo[i].unauthAttr.`"1.2.840.113549.1.9.16.2.14`".verify.signerInfo[j].authAttr.`"1.2.840.113549.1.9.16.2.47`".der")
            $j = $j + 1
        }

    }

    $i = $i + 1
}

if ($success -ne $true) {
    $($crypt.LastErrorText)
    $("CAdES-T verification failed.")
}
else {
    $("CAdES-T signature is valid.")
}
